UK can take the lead in AI technologyThe UK has the potential to lead the world in the application of artificial intelligence for manufacturing, according to an AI specialist at Coventry’s Manufacturing Technology Centre (MTC).

Nandini Chakravorti, technology manager for the data and information systems team, said that the UK has the largest artificial-intelligence and machine-learning markets in Europe, with more than 200 SMEs in the field (compared to just 80 in Germany).

She added: “The UK has a tremendous platform to capitalise on these new disruptive technologies.

“Artificial intelligence has huge potential to revolutionise manufacturing in areas such as predictive maintenance, quality control and faster designs.”

However, she warned that the industrial take-up of AI was impeded by a number of key factors.

“The adoption of AI in industry has been slow for a number of reasons.

“These include lack of leadership knowledge and awareness, lack of support for start-ups and a lack of clarity on the return on investment.

“Developing an artificial-intelligence strategy with clearly defined financial and effectiveness goals, finding individuals with the appropriate skill sets, clear ownership and strategic commitment to AI on the part of leaders are some of the ways forward to ensure that AI is deployed to get benefits. The potential is enormous.”
